Expedition

M5K: From aerial imagery, I was 99% sure that this hashpoint, in a farm field surrounded by suburban development, would be inaccessible. But, I was passing within a mile, so I went to check. I don't think I've ever seen so many different kinds of No Trespassing signs in one place in my life.

Jim also went by and found the same assortment of signs. There's a railroad track right there some some of them relate to the railroad track/crossing.
